F280045PMSRTI C2000™高性能实时控制MCU深度解析在电机驱动、数字电源、光伏逆变器以及汽车电子等对实时控制有苛刻要求的应用中通用微控制器往往难以兼顾高精度数学运算与快速响应的控制环路。德州仪器Texas Instruments推出的C2000™系列实时微控制器正是为解决这一需求而设计而F280045PMSR作为F28004x系列的高性价比成员在64引脚LQFP封装内集成了100MHz C28x DSP内核、256KB闪存、100KB RAM以及丰富的模拟和控制外设为工业实时控制系统提供了强大的单芯片解决方案。F280045PMSR是德州仪器Texas Instruments推出的一款基于C28x内核的32位实时微控制器属于C2000™ Piccolo™系列。该器件采用64引脚LQFPPM封装在10mm×10mm的紧凑尺寸内集成了100MHz C28x DSP内核、256KB Flash存储器、100KB SRAM支持浮点运算单元FPU、三角函数加速器TMU和控制律加速器CLA并提供了14通道12位ADC、16路高分辨率PWM、7个可编程增益放大器PGA以及多种工业通信接口为电机控制、数字电源及工业自动化等实时控制应用提供了高性能、高灵活性的单芯片解决方案。一、核心架构C28x DSP 浮点运算与控制加速F280045PMSR基于德州仪器经典的C28x 32位DSP内核该内核针对实时控制应用进行了深度优化在100MHz主频下提供100MIPS的处理能力。架构参数规格说明核心处理器C28x 32位DSP实时控制优化内核最高频率100 MHz100 MIPS处理能力浮点单元IEEE 754单精度FPU硬件浮点加速三角函数加速器TMU硬件加速3-4周期执行三角函数Viterbi/复杂数学单元VCU-I硬件加速加速编码和复杂数学控制律加速器CLA独立32位浮点协处理器与主CPU并行执行1.1 C28x DSP内核F280045PMSR搭载的TMS320C28x 32位DSP CPU运行频率达100MHz提供100MIPS的信号处理性能。相比通用MCU内核C28x针对实时控制应用中的数字信号处理任务进行了专门优化具备更快的数学运算能力和更低的中断延迟。1.2 浮点单元FPU集成IEEE 754单精度浮点单元FPU是该器件的核心优势之一。传统的定点处理器需要软件模拟浮点运算会消耗大量CPU周期和程序空间。硬件FPU可在单个周期内完成浮点运算这对于电机控制中的矢量控制算法、数字电源中的PID调节等需要高精度数学运算的应用至关重要。1.3 三角函数加速器TMUTMUTrigonometric Math Unit扩展指令集是该器件的特色硬件加速单元。在Park/Clark变换、空间矢量PWMSVPWM等电机控制算法中正弦、余弦等三角函数的计算是常见瓶颈。TMU将此类运算效率提升至3-4个时钟周期相比软件实现加速数倍。1.4 控制律加速器CLA控制律加速器CLA是一款与主C28x CPU并行的独立32位浮点数学加速器。CLA可以独立执行代码直接访问控制系统中所需的关键外设从而实现主CPU的负载卸载。典型应用包括双电机控制主CPU控制一台电机CLA控制另一台复杂算法并行处理CPU处理通信和系统管理CLA处理控制环路降低响应延迟CLA响应时间比CPU中断更快二、存储器资源双分区闪存与ECC保护F280045PMSR提供了充足的片上存储资源并配备了完整的数据保护机制。存储器参数规格说明闪存Flash256KB128KW分为两个128KB存储体SRAM100KB50KW分为4KB和16KB块闪存ECC支持错误校验和纠正SRAM保护ECC/奇偶校验数据完整性保护双区安全支持代码保护和安全隔离2.1 256KB Flash存储器F280045PMSR集成了256KB128KW的片上闪存分为两个128KB64KW存储体支持并行编程和执行。这意味着在擦写一个存储体的同时可以从另一个存储体执行代码这对于需要在现场进行固件升级的应用至关重要。2.2 100KB SRAM100KB50KW的片上SRAM以4KB2KW和16KB8KW块的方式组织支持高效的系统分区。充足的RAM空间可支持复杂的软件栈和大量数据缓冲。2.3 ECC与数据保护闪存ECC错误校验和纠正和SRAM ECC/奇偶校验是该器件在可靠性方面的重要特性。在工业现场和汽车应用中电磁干扰和辐射可能导致存储器位翻转ECC可检测并纠正单比特错误防止系统异常。2.4 双区安全双区安全机制提供了硬件级代码保护。通过将闪存划分为两个安全区域设计人员可保护专有IP如核心算法库防止未经授权的读取或篡改。三、模拟外设精密信号链集成F280045PMSR集成了高性能模拟外设包括3个独立的12位ADC、7个可编程增益放大器PGA以及模拟比较器实现了从模拟信号采集到数字控制的完整信号链。模拟参数规格说明ADC分辨率12位3个独立ADC模块ADC采样率3.45 MSPS最高采样速率ADC外部通道21路最多外部模拟输入后处理块PPB每个ADC 4个硬件级信号处理PGA7个可编程增益3/6/12/24比较器CMPSS7个带12位DAC参考缓冲DAC2个12位分辨率3.1 12位ADC3.45 MSPS采样F280045PMSR集成了三个独立的12位逐次逼近型ADC最高采样率达3.45MSPS。三个ADC可并行工作同时采样多路模拟信号这对于电机控制中的三相电流同时采样至关重要。ADC通道与资源最多21个外部模拟输入通道通过GPIO复用每个ADC带有4个集成后处理块PPB可实现硬件级的中断触发和结果比较支持差分和单端输入配置3.2 可编程增益放大器PGA该器件集成了7个可编程增益放大器PGA可编程增益设置为3、6、12和24倍。PGA的价值在于直接连接分流电阻在电机电流检测中分流电阻上的电压信号微小PGA可将其放大至ADC的满量程范围无需外部运放减少BOM元件数量和PCB面积片上输出滤波降低噪声影响3.3 比较器CMPSS7个带12位DAC的窗口比较器CMPSS比较器子系统提供了强大的过流、过压保护能力。每个CMPSS包含两个比较器形成高/低阈值窗口12位DAC生成可编程阈值电压数字干扰滤波器防止误触发可直接连接ePWM的跳闸区TZ输入实现微秒级硬件保护3.4 12位缓冲DACF280045PMSR还提供了两个12位缓冲DAC输出可生成可编程的模拟参考电压。典型应用包括为外部电路提供参考电压生成模拟指令信号系统自校准四、控制外设高精度PWM与位置反馈F280045PMSR配备了业界领先的控制外设包括16个高分辨率ePWM通道、7个eCAP模块和2个eQEP模块。控制参数规格说明ePWM通道16通道增强型PWM高分辨率PWMHRPWM150ps分辨率高精度占空比控制eCAP模块7个增强型捕捉模块HRCAP2个高分辨率捕捉eQEP2个增强型正交编码器脉冲SDFM通道4输入Σ-Δ滤波器模块4.1 高分辨率PWMHRPWMF280045PMSR提供16个ePWM通道其中多个通道支持高分辨率PWMHRPWM脉宽调节分辨率高达150ps。150ps分辨率的价值数字电源实现输出电压的高精度调节降低纹波电机控制更精细的电压矢量控制降低转矩脉动频率合成生成高精度频率信号4.2 增强型捕捉eCAP与高分辨率捕捉HRCAP该器件集成了7个eCAP模块其中2个模块支持高分辨率捕捉HRCAP。eCAP可用于测量PWM信号的周期和占空比解码来自霍尔传感器的速度反馈测量脉冲间的时间间隔4.3 正交编码器脉冲eQEP2个eQEP模块可直接连接电机轴端的增量式编码器实时读取电机转速旋转方向绝对位置4.4 Σ-Δ滤波器模块SDFM4个SDFM输入通道每条通道配有2个并联滤波器允许连接外部Σ-Δ调制器。这在高性能隔离式电流检测中非常有价值支持使用隔离Σ-Δ调制器如AMC1306实现隔离电流采样内置比较器滤波器支持快速过流检测五、通信接口工业与车载互联F280045PMSR集成了丰富的通信接口支持工业自动化系统和车载网络的多种连接需求。通信接口数量说明CAN多通道2个CAN 2.0BLIN1个本地互连网络UART/SCI3个通用异步收发器SPI2个串行外设接口I²C2个内部集成电路PMBus1个电源管理总线FSI1个快速串行接口5.1 多通道CAN该器件集成了2个CAN总线端口支持引脚引导Pin-Bootable。CAN总线是工业自动化和汽车电子的标准现场总线2个独立CAN通道可实现同时连接两个独立CAN网络冗余通信提高可靠性网关功能不同CAN网络之间转发数据5.2 快速串行接口FSI快速串行接口FSI是C2000平台新增的高速可靠的通信接口。FSI的特点包括高速点对点通信可跨越隔离屏障特别适合隔离系统低引脚数占用5.3 PMBusPMBus电源管理总线是专门针对数字电源管理的通信标准。对于数字电源应用PMBus可实现输出电压/电流的远程监控故障状态的读取参数的在线配置六、功能安全与可靠性F280045PMSR在功能安全方面的特性使其成为汽车和安全关键型工业应用的理想选择。安全特性规格说明ISO 26262认证硬件完整性高达ASIL BTÜV SÜD认证系统功能安全支持ASIL D和SIL 3系统设计提供安全文档安全手册可用ISO 26262和IEC 61508文档闪存ECC支持单比特纠错SRAM ECC/奇偶校验支持数据完整性时钟丢失检测支持失效保护看门狗定时器窗口看门狗程序监控6.1 ISO 26262认证该器件硬件完整性高达ASIL B级通过了TÜV SÜD的ISO 26262认证。对于汽车安全相关应用如电动助力转向、制动系统、电池管理ASIL B级硬件完整性是满足系统级安全要求的基础。6.2 功能安全文档支持德州仪器为F280045PMSR提供完整的功能安全文档包括安全手册描述器件安全特性、故障模式和使用假设FIT每十亿小时故障数数据故障模式影响和诊断分析FMEDA这些文档使系统设计者能够更高效地完成ISO 26262或IEC 61508的安全认证。6.3 内置安全机制时钟丢失检测MCD当系统时钟丢失时自动切换到内部振荡器并触发安全响应窗口化看门狗与标准看门狗相比可检测过早点喂狗的情况欠压复位BOR和上电复位POR错误信号输入可接受来自外部安全器件的错误信号七、电源与封装规格7.1 电源要求F280045PMSR采用1.2V内核、3.3V I/O设计。电源轨规格说明内核电压VDD1.14V ~ 1.32V可通过内部LDO或外部供电I/O电压VDDIO3.3V3.0V~3.6V模拟电源VDDA3.3V3.0V~3.6V内部稳压器可生成1.2V允许单电源设计内部电压稳压器VREG允许使用单个3.3V电源为器件供电简化了电源系统设计。对于功耗敏感的应用也可使用外部1.2V电源直接为内核供电以获得更高效率。7.2 封装规格F280045PMSR采用64引脚LQFP封装Low-profile Quad Flat Package后缀PM标识。封装参数规格说明封装类型LQFP-64薄型四边扁平封装封装尺寸10mm × 10mm标准LQFP-64尺寸引脚间距0.5mm标准间距I/O数量26个可配置GPIO引脚总数64含电源和专用功能引脚LQFP封装的特点与优势四边引脚布局便于PCB布线信号扇出容易0.5mm间距平衡引脚密度和可制造性引脚外露便于手工焊接和目视检查10×10mm尺寸占板面积适中适合紧凑设计7.3 环境与可靠性参数规格说明工作温度结温-40°C ~ 125°C工业/汽车级湿敏等级MSL3168小时标准车间寿命RoHS合规ROHS3 Compliant无铅环保REACH合规REACH Unaffected符合欧盟法规ECCN分类3A991A2出口管制分类汽车级认证部分型号-Q1后缀AEC-Q100根据具体后缀八、包装信息F280045PMSR以卷带包装Tape Reel形式供应标准包装规格如下包装参数规格包装类型Tape Reel卷带标准包装数量1,000片/卷卷盘直径330mm卷盘宽度24.4mmA013.0mmB013.0mmK02.1mm如需托盘包装或其他特殊包装建议咨询TI或授权分销商确认可行性。九、开发工具与生态系统F280045PMSR拥有完整成熟的C2000开发生态系统。9.1 开发硬件开发板/评估模块说明TMDSCNCD280049CF28004x系列controlCARD用于原型开发LAUNCHXL-F280049CLaunchPad开发套件低成本入门9.2 开发软件与库软件/工具说明C2000Ware官方软件开发套件SDK含外设驱动、示例代码MotorControl SDK电机控制专用软件库DigitalPower SDK数字电源专用软件库SysConfig外设图形化配置工具UniFlash独立闪存编程工具Code Composer StudioCCSTI官方集成开发环境9.3 InstaSPIN-FOC专门实现的器件型号F28004xC支持InstaSPIN-FOC无传感器磁场定向控制片上ROM存储器包含用于支持InstaSPIN-FOC的库。这使得电机控制开发者可快速实现无传感器FOC无需编码器即可实现高性能电机控制电机参数识别自动识别电机电气参数FAST™软件编码器高精度转子位置估算9.4 可配置逻辑块CLB专门实现的器件型号F28004xC允许访问可配置逻辑块CLB以实现额外连接功能。CLB可用于实现自定义外设接口卸载简单逻辑功能增强现有外设功能十、应用场景分析基于100MHz C28x DSP内核、256KB闪存、丰富的模拟和控制外设组合F280045PMSR适用于以下应用场景10.1 电机控制核心应用应用实现方式关键特性匹配伺服驱动器矢量控制FOC 位置/速度环TMU 16路ePWM eQEP交流驱动器VFDV/F控制或FOCCLA FPU PGA无刷直流电机BLDC控制无传感器FOCInstaSPINROM库 TMU 高速ADC步进电机控制微步进驱动高分辨率PWM电动汽车牵引电机高功率电机控制-40°C~125°C 功能安全在伺服驱动器中TMU加速Park/Clark变换CLA与主CPU并行运行可同时处理电流环、速度环和通信任务eQEP模块可直接连接编码器读取位置反馈。10.2 数字电源核心应用应用实现方式关键特性匹配AC-DC电源PFC功率因数校正高分辨率PWM 高速ADCDC-DC转换器移相全桥、同步整流150ps HRPWM PMBus车载充电器OBC双向AC-DC/DC-DC3.45MSPS ADC 2xCAN通信电源整流器高功率密度硬件保护CMPSS光伏逆变器DC-AC转换 MPPTFPU 多通道ADC在数字电源应用中150ps HRPWM可实现输出电压的高精度控制CMPSS窗口比较器提供逐周期的过流保护PMBus接口支持电源参数的远程监控和配置。10.3 工业自动化应用实现方式关键特性匹配PLC模拟输入模块多通道信号采集14通道ADC PGA工业机器人多轴运动控制16路ePWM 2个eQEP自动分拣设备高速位置控制eCAP eQEP电梯门驱动控制电机驱动 位置闭环100MHz实时处理10.4 汽车电子应用实现方式关键特性匹配电动助力转向EPS扭矩控制 安全监控ASIL B CAN-FD车载充电器OBCAC-DC/DC-DC转换高精度ADC 高分辨率PWM空调压缩机驱动无传感器FOCTMU InstaSPIN电动汽车无线充电功率控制通信PMBus 双CAN-40°C至125°C宽温范围和ISO 26262 ASIL B认证是该器件在汽车电子应用中的核心优势。10.5 新能源与电网应用实现方式关键特性匹配光伏逆变器组串式MPPT DC-ACFPU 3.45MSPS ADC储能PCS双向功率变换16路PWM PMBus不间断电源UPSAC-DC-AC变换高分辨率PWM 快速保护电动汽车充电站电源模块大功率AC-DC工业通信接口CAN/FSIF280045PMSR | Texas Instruments | TI | C2000 | Piccolo | 实时微控制器 | 32位MCU | C28x DSP | 100MHz | 256KB Flash | 100KB SRAM | FPU | TMU | CLA | 12位ADC | 3.45MSPS | PGA | ePWM | HRPWM | eCAP | eQEP | SDFM | CAN | LIN | SPI | I²C | PMBus | FSI | 功能安全 | ISO 26262 | ASIL B | -40°C~125°C | LQFP-64 | 电机控制 | 数字电源 | 伺服驱动 | 车载充电器 | 光伏逆变器 | 工业自动化 | InstaSPIN | C2000WareEmail: carrotaunytorchips.com